Разработка бота для предложки в Telegram: максимальная эффективность и удобство использования

В настоящее время Telegram является одной из самых популярных платформ для общения и обмена информацией. Многие компании и предприниматели активно используют Telegram для взаимодействия с клиентами и решения различных задач. Поэтому разработка бота для предложки в Telegram становится все более актуальной и востребованной задачей.

Основная цель бота для предложки в Telegram — упростить и автоматизировать процесс получения и обработки предложений и запросов от клиентов и пользователей. Благодаря боту, клиенты смогут быстро оставить свое сообщение или заявку, а компания или предприниматель — оперативно получить и обработать эту информацию.

Разработка бота для предложки в Telegram отличается высокой эффективностью и удобством использования. Благодаря простому и интуитивно понятному интерфейсу, пользователи легко справляются с заполнением формы и отправкой предложения. Компания или предприниматель, в свою очередь, получают все необходимые данные для дальнейшей обработки и решения клиентских запросов.

Кроме того, разработка бота для предложки в Telegram позволяет существенно сократить время и силы, затрачиваемые на обработку предложений и ответы на них. Бот автоматически собирает и систематизирует информацию, что позволяет с легкостью находить необходимые данные и отслеживать динамику работы с клиентами и потребителями.

Итак, основываясь на преимуществах и возможностях Telegram, разработка бота для предложки становится неотъемлемым инструментом для многих компаний и предпринимателей. Реализация данного бота обеспечивает максимальную эффективность и удобство использования, позволяет автоматизировать процесс получения предложений, сократить время и силы на их обработку, а также повысить качество взаимодействия с клиентами и потребителями.

Разработка бота в Telegram:

Разработка бота в Telegram может быть выполнена с использованием различных языков программирования и платформ. Однако одной из самых популярных платформ для разработки ботов в Telegram является Telegram Bot API. Этот API предоставляет широкие возможности для работы с ботами и позволяет разработчикам создавать мощные и удобные боты.

Основные этапы разработки бота в Telegram включают:

  1. Создание и настройка нового бота через BotFather, специального Telegram-бота, который поможет сгенерировать токен и настроить основные параметры бота.
  2. Написание кода бота, используя Telegram Bot API и выбранный язык программирования.
  3. Регистрация вебхука для бота, чтобы Telegram мог отправлять входящие запросы на заданный URL.
  4. Тестирование и отладка бота, чтобы убедиться, что он работает правильно и выполняет все необходимые функции.
  5. Развертывание бота на выбранном хостинге или сервере, чтобы он был доступен для использования.
  6. Постоянное обновление и поддержка бота, чтобы он соответствовал требованиям и потребностям пользователей.

Разработка бота в Telegram может быть сложной задачей, требующей знания соответствующих технологий и особенностей платформы. Однако с правильным подходом и пониманием потребностей пользователей, боты в Telegram могут стать мощным инструментом для улучшения коммуникации и процессов в различных сферах деятельности.

Максимальная эффективность и удобство использования

Во-первых, важно обеспечить удобный и интуитивно понятный интерфейс для пользователей. Бот должен быть простым в использовании, чтобы любой пользователь мог без труда освоить его функционал. Для этого можно использовать понятные команды или кнопки меню, которые будут группировать основные функции бота и помогать пользователям быстро найти нужную информацию или выполнить нужное действие.

Во-вторых, эффективность разработанного бота можно обеспечить с помощью автоматизации определенных процессов. Например, можно использовать функцию автозаполнения форм, чтобы пользователю не приходилось вручную вводить однотипные данные или повторять одни и те же действия. Также можно предусмотреть возможность сохранения настроек и предпочтений пользователя, чтобы бот мог предлагать релевантную информацию и рекомендации на основе предыдущих действий.

В-третьих, для достижения максимальной эффективности бота необходимо предусмотреть поддержку различных языков и локализацию. Это позволит удовлетворить потребности пользователей из разных стран и обеспечить им комфортное взаимодействие с ботом. Кроме того, важно предусмотреть возможность быстрой и удобной загрузки контента, чтобы пользователи не тратили лишнее время на ожидание.

Наконец, также важно регулярно анализировать и улучшать работу бота на основе обратной связи пользователей. Систематическое сбор и анализ данных поможет выявить слабые места и узкие места бота, чтобы можно было внести соответствующие изменения и улучшить его функционал.

Суммируя, разработка бота для предложки в Telegram должна учитывать удобство использования и максимальную эффективность. Удобный и интуитивно понятный интерфейс, автоматизация процессов, поддержка разных языков и анализ обратной связи пользователей являются ключевыми моментами, которые помогут достичь вышеупомянутых целей.

Процесс разработки бота:

  1. Определение целей и функциональности бота. В начале процесса следует четко определить, какие задачи будет выполнять бот и какую функциональность он должен предлагать пользователям.
  2. Проектирование архитектуры бота. В этом шаге вы определяете структуру и взаимодействие компонентов бота, чтобы обеспечить его правильное функционирование.
  3. Выбор платформы и языка программирования. Вам необходимо выбрать платформу для разработки бота, а также язык программирования, на котором будет написан код бота. Telegram Bot API предоставляет широкий выбор возможностей для создания ботов.
  4. Написание кода бота. С использованием выбранного языка программирования и соответствующих инструментов разработки, вы начинаете писать код для реализации функциональности бота.
  5. Тестирование и отладка. Необходимо провести тестирование различных функций и сценариев использования бота, чтобы выявить и исправить возможные ошибки.
  6. Развёртывание бота. После завершения разработки и успешного прохождения тестирования бота, следует развернуть его на выбранной платформе (например, на сервере).
  7. Поддержка и обновления. Не забывайте о том, что разработка бота – это непрерывный процесс. Пользователи могут предлагать новые идеи и функции, которые могут быть внедрены в будущих обновлениях.

Следуя данному процессу разработки бота, вы сможете создать эффективный и удобный в использовании продукт, который будет полезен пользователю в решении его задач.

Определение функционала и целей

В первую очередь, бот должен обладать функционалом, необходимым для предложки в Telegram. Это может включать в себя:

  • возможность отправки предложений боту;
  • обработку полученных предложений и их классификацию;
  • автоматическую рассылку предложений заданным адресатам;
  • хранение предложений в базе данных.

Дополнительно, может быть полезным:

  • возможность отображения статистики по предложкам;
  • реализация аналитики для анализа полученных предложений;
  • мультиязычность для удобства пользователей на разных языках;
  • интерфейс администратора для управления предложками и настройками.

Цель разработки бота для предложки в Telegram – создать максимально эффективный и удобный инструмент для сбора и обработки предложений. Бот должен быть прост в использовании, надежным и гарантировать конфиденциальность полученных данных. Оптимизация процесса работы с предложками и повышение эффективности управления ими являются ключевыми целями разработки.

Выбор платформы и инструментов

Выбор платформы зависит от многих факторов, включая командные навыки разработчиков, требования к функциональности, бюджет и другие ограничения. На сегодняшний день наиболее популярными платформами для разработки ботов в Telegram являются Python, Node.js и PHP. Каждая из этих платформ имеет свои особенности и предлагает собственные инструменты для работы.

Python – один из самых популярных языков программирования, используемых для создания ботов в Telegram. Он обладает простым и понятным синтаксисом, большим количеством библиотек и фреймворков, которые значительно упрощают разработку. Одним из самых популярных инструментов для разработки ботов в Telegram на Python является библиотека pyTelegramBotAPI.

Node.js – другая популярная платформа, которая позволяет разрабатывать ботов в Telegram с использованием языка JavaScript. Node.js отлично подходит для создания высокопроизводительных и отзывчивых ботов благодаря своей асинхронной и событийно-ориентированной архитектуре. Для разработки ботов в Telegram на Node.js можно использовать библиотеки Telegraf или node-telegram-bot-api.

PHP – язык программирования, который широко используется для создания веб-приложений, включая ботов в Telegram. PHP отлично подходит для создания ботов с простой логикой, особенно если у вас уже есть опыт работы с этим языком. Для разработки ботов в Telegram на PHP можно использовать библиотеку TelegramBotAPI.

Выбор платформы и инструментов для разработки бота в Telegram является ключевым шагом в создании эффективного и удобного в использовании бота. При выборе необходимо учитывать цели и требования проекта, а также собственные навыки и опыт разработчиков.

Язык программирования Популярные инструменты
Python pyTelegramBotAPI
Node.js Telegraf, node-telegram-bot-api
PHP TelegramBotAPI

Проектирование структуры и архитектуры

Для разработки бота для предложки в Telegram требуется тщательное проектирование его структуры и архитектуры. Это позволит создать максимально эффективное и удобное в использовании приложение.

Первым шагом в проектировании структуры и архитектуры бота является определение его основных функциональных возможностей. Необходимо ясно понимать, какие задачи должен выполнять бот и какие функции он должен поддерживать.

Далее следует определить взаимодействие пользователя с ботом. На основе этого определения можно разработать структуру команд и сообщений, которые будут использоваться для взаимодействия с ботом. От этого зависит возможность простого и удобного использования бота.

Следующим шагом является проектирование логики бота. Это включает в себя определение алгоритмов обработки команд и сообщений от пользователя, а также определение логики работы бота внутри команд. От правильно разработанной логики зависит корректность работы бота и его эффективность.

Важным аспектом проектирования структуры и архитектуры является также выбор подходящей архитектурной модели. Разработчику следует выбрать ту модель, которая наилучшим образом соответствует требованиям проекта и обеспечивает максимальную отказоустойчивость и масштабируемость бота.

В процессе разработки структуры и архитектуры бота важно также учесть возможность его дальнейшей поддержки и развития. Планирование будущих изменений и расширений позволит изначально создать гибкую и адаптируемую архитектуру.

Таким образом, правильное проектирование структуры и архитектуры — это один из ключевых этапов разработки бота для предложки в Telegram. Это позволит создать эффективное и удобное в использовании приложение, которое будет удовлетворять потребностям пользователей.

Важные особенности бота:

2. Интеграция с Telegram — бот разработан для использования в Telegram, что делает его доступным и удобным в использовании для широкой аудитории пользователей.

3. Личный кабинет — бот позволяет пользователям создавать личный кабинет, где они могут просматривать и отслеживать свои заявки, а также получать уведомления о статусе заявки.

4. Автоматический распределитель — бот имеет функцию автоматического распределения заявок между операторами, что позволяет сократить время реакции и обработки заявок.

5. Интеллектуальный подбор предложений — бот использует алгоритмы машинного обучения для анализа предложек и предложения наиболее подходящих вариантов пользователям.

6. Возможность онлайн-оплаты — бот предлагает удобную возможность онлайн-оплаты прямо через приложение, что экономит время пользователей и упрощает процесс оплаты.

7. Интеграция с базой данных — бот подключается к базе данных, где хранятся все предложки и заявки, что позволяет операторам быстро получать и обрабатывать информацию.

8. Многоязычный интерфейс — бот поддерживает несколько языков, что делает его доступным для пользователей из разных стран и культур.

Особенности Преимущества
Автоматизация процесса — Сокращение времени обработки заявок
— Удобство для пользователей
Интеграция с Telegram — Широкая доступность
— Удобство использования
Личный кабинет — Возможность отслеживать заявки
— Уведомления о статусе заявки
Автоматический распределитель — Сокращение времени реакции
— Равномерное распределение нагрузки
Интеллектуальный подбор предложений — Улучшение пользовательского опыта
— Более точное предложение
Возможность онлайн-оплаты — Экономия времени
— Упрощение процесса оплаты
Интеграция с базой данных — Быстрый доступ к информации
— Улучшение эффективности работы
Многоязычный интерфейс — Доступность для разных пользователей
— Улучшение коммуникации
Понравилась статья? Поделиться с друзьями:
Портал с гайдами
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: